FR 1958305 — Roaring River Ridge in OR
A 5.0-mile stretch of gravel National Forest road in Lane County, OR.
Willamette National Forest, McKenzie River Ranger District allows dispersed camping here -- 14-day limit in any 30 days.
All 5 miles in are maintained only for high-clearance vehicles. Mostly gravel, with 0.6 miles of dirt. Climbs 1,400 ft over 5 miles -- sustained grades near 20%, with pitches to 40%. Stretches run along a shelf with a drop of up to ~110 ft on the downhill side.
Chucksney Mountain stands 1,323 ft above the site, 3.0 miles northwest. The nearest town, Oakridge, is 23 mi off.
September normals 40–68°F, 2.1″ rain. Monthly averages, PRISM 1991–2020.
